我在CDrawCoinDoc 类中声明了一个public 变量int m_nCoins;但是我调用的时候出现.......:'m_nCoins' : is not a member of 'CDC'
void CDrawCoinView::OnDraw(CDC* pDC)
{
CDrawCoinDoc* pDoc = GetDocument();
ASSERT_VALID(pDoc);
// TODO: add draw code for native data here
>>> for(int i=0;i<(pDC-> m_nCoins);i++)
{
int y = 200-10*i;
pDC->Ellipse(200,y,300,y-300);
pDC->Ellipse(200,y-10,300,y-35);
}
}请高手指教,谢谢谢谢。
源代码是从《Visual C++面向对象编程教程》清华大学出版社 王育坚编著的165页得到。
void CDrawCoinView::OnDraw(CDC* pDC)
{
CDrawCoinDoc* pDoc = GetDocument();
ASSERT_VALID(pDoc);
// TODO: add draw code for native data here
>>> for(int i=0;i<(pDC-> m_nCoins);i++)
{
int y = 200-10*i;
pDC->Ellipse(200,y,300,y-300);
pDC->Ellipse(200,y-10,300,y-35);
}
}请高手指教,谢谢谢谢。
源代码是从《Visual C++面向对象编程教程》清华大学出版社 王育坚编著的165页得到。
解决方案 »
- 【提问】vs2008,写VC程序,控件中的汉字全是乱码“???”【在线放分】
- ****又一个简单的问题*****
- 在本地用ADO连接SQLServer正常,换到别人的机器上怎么就不行了?
- Radio Button如何使用?
- 各位高人,我在多线程访问数据库时出现了这样的错误,MSADO15! 1f4412b0(),请指教,谢谢!
- 类的问题,紧急求助!!!!!!!!!!!!
- 写了近一个月的Shell程序,想好好学学COM了,请有经验的人说说怎样开头?
- 怎么样编译驱动程序(vc++ 6.0 + ddk2000)或者(vc++ 6.0 + ddk98)?
- MFC编写的activex控件,用c#调用,我想在c#的控件事件中从activex传图片过来,该如何解决
- DLL引用的问题
- 如何修改文档框架状态栏和工具栏的背景色
- 下拉列表框的背景色
把pDC-> m_nCoins改成pDoc-> m_nCoins